Mid-Level DevOps Engineer at Abyss Solutions
Haymarket NSW 2000, , Australia -
Full Time


Start Date

Immediate

Expiry Date

20 Nov, 25

Salary

140000.0

Posted On

20 Aug, 25

Experience

4 year(s) or above

Remote Job

Yes

Telecommute

Yes

Sponsor Visa

No

Skills

Good communication skills

Industry

Information Technology/IT

Description

ABOUT ABYSS

At Abyss, we’re on a mission to transform asset integrity management for industrial operations through intelligent, user-centric digital products. Our platform empowers clients to manage complex inspection data, prioritize maintenance, and extend asset life—all with confidence and clarity.

Responsibilities

ABOUT THE ROLE

As we continue to grow, we’re looking for a Creative technology specialist with experience in Business Administration and internal Operations management who can help shape the direction of our products and company.
We’re looking for a passionate and experienced Mid-Level DevOps Engineer to join our growing team! You’ll be a key player in designing, building, and maintaining the scalable, resilient, and secure infrastructure that powers our applications. If you love automating everything, have a deep understanding of cloud technologies, and enjoy collaborating with development teams to ship code faster and more reliably, this is the role for you.

WHAT YOU’LL DO

  • Build and Manage Cloud Infrastructure: Design, provision, and manage our multi-cloud infrastructure across AWS, GCP, and Azure using Infrastructure as Code (IaC) principles, primarily with Terraform.
  • Orchestrate and Containerize: Develop and maintain our Kubernetes clusters, managing containerized applications (Docker) from development to production.
  • Automate Everything: Own and improve our CI/CD pipelines to enable rapid, safe, and automated deployments. You’ll be scripting in languages like Python and Bash to eliminate manual processes.
  • Ensure System Reliability: Manage and scale our production web environments, ensuring high availability and performance. You’ll troubleshoot complex issues across the stack, from networking to application level.
  • Monitor and Observe: Implement and manage our monitoring, logging, and alerting stack using tools like Prometheus, Grafana, and Loki to provide deep visibility into system health.
  • Collaborate and Innovate: Work closely with software engineers to optimize application performance and reliability. You’ll manage source code and branching strategies using Git/GitHub and champion DevOps best practices throughout the engineering organization.
  • Configure and Secure: Utilize Configuration Management tools (we love SaltStack!) to ensure our Linux-based systems are consistently configured, patched, and secure.
Loading...